2. Defining Learning Outcomes: Set Clear Objectives
Crafting Your Online Course: A What Are Learning Outcomes?: Think of learning outcomes as the compass for your course—they guide you and your learners through the educational journey. Clear outcomes define what students should know, feel, or be able to do by the end of your course. Without them, it’s like sailing without a map.
How to Craft Effective Learning Outcomes: Be specific! Instead of saying, “Students will understand the basics of photography,” try, “Students will be able to manually adjust their camera settings to capture high-quality images.” This makes it not just a goal, but a tangible achievement your learners can strive for.
3. Structuring Your Course Content: The Backbone of Effective Learning
Choosing a Course Format: There’s a buffet of formats you can choose from—videos, written content, podcasts, quizzes, or even live sessions. Each has its pros and cons. Video is engaging but time-consuming, while written content is easier to produce but might not capture attention as effectively. What matters most is finding the format that resonates with your audience.
Creating a Course Outline: Now, let’s get to the meat of it! Start with a rough outline and gradually build it out. What’s the first thing learners need to know? What’s next? I find it helpful to organize content in a way that builds upon previous lessons. Think of it like stacking blocks—each layer makes the structure more robust.
4. Designing Engaging Learning Materials: Bringing Content to Life
Utilizing Multimedia: In a world where attention spans are shorter than a TikTok video, keeping your learners engaged is essential! Mix things up with multimedia elements. Incorporate visuals, audio snippets, or interactive quizzes—we all love a good challenge, right?
eLearning Best Practices: Remember, less can be more. Overloading learners with too much information at once can lead to cognitive overload. Shorter, focused lessons generally work better, allowing room for reflection and assimilation of new info.

7. Monetizing Online Education: Turning Passion into Profit
Exploring Revenue Models: There’s no one-size-fits-all approach here. You could go for a one-time purchase, a subscription model, or even dabble in affiliate marketing. Each has its perks, so think about what aligns best with your content and audience.
